Evenflo surveyed 1,000 parents from around the country with children under the age of 5 and here are some of the survey statistics:
- More time on the road often puts safety concerns into high gear. And it can trigger tears of frustration – in kids AND parents.
- The biggest worry parents have when taking car trips is that their young child will be harmed in a collision (76%).
- Integral to a safe ride is proper car-seat installation, but a full 65% of mothers and 72% of fathers encounter challenges when installing car seats.
- Some 48% of parents worry about keeping their child entertained while in their car seat.
- Attending to a baby while driving causes 38% of parents to miss their exit once in a while, 12% to miss their exit often and 38% to get lost.
- 34% worry that their little Houdini will wiggle out of the car seat
- 32% worry their child will have a temper tantrum
- And – oh baby! – nearly half (49%) admit that installing the car seat caused them to sweat more than actually making the baby did!
